Understanding Usual Home Appliance Problems
When your home appliances start breaking down, it can feel overwhelming, specifically if you're not certain what the issue is. Usual issues usually develop with refrigerators, washing machines, and clothes dryers, and understanding what to try to find can conserve you time and anxiety. If your fridge isn't cooling down, examine the temperature level setups or listen for uncommon sounds that might indicate a failing compressor.With cleaning machines, leaks generally stem from worn hoses or defective door seals. If your dryer isn't home heating, a clogged air vent may be the perpetrator.
Necessary Tools for DIY Services
Having the right tools can make all the difference in your DIY device repair service initiatives. Beginning with a trustworthy toolset that consists of screwdrivers-- both flathead and Phillips-- since numerous devices use these kinds of screws. A durable pair of pliers is vital for gripping, twisting, or reducing cords. You'll also desire a socket set for removing bolts and nuts that hold devices together.A multimeter is important for examining electrical connections and diagnosing issues. Don't neglect a level to assure your appliances rest properly, as this can impact efficiency. Take into consideration purchasing a torque wrench for specific tightening demands. Finally, a good flashlight or work light will aid you see right into tight or dark areas. With these devices in hand, you'll be fully equipped to take on most DIY device fixings with self-confidence.

Source Of Power Precautions
Making certain that a home appliance is separated from its source of power is crucial for your safety during repair work (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service Dryer repair near additional resources me). Prior to you begin, disconnect the device or shut off the breaker. This basic step protects against electric shocks or crashes. Always double-check fix fridge seal with hair dryer that the power is off making use of a voltage tester-- do not depend on presumptions! If you're working with bigger devices, consider using a lockout/tagout system to stop unintentional reactivation. Maintain your workspace dry and free from mess to minimize risks. Use protected handwear covers and use devices with rubber grasps to give extra protection. Finally, never effort fixings in damp conditions, as water and electricity don't mix. By adhering to these precautions, you'll produce a safer setting for your do it yourself repair project

Preserving Your Home Appliances for Long life
To assure your appliances offer you well for several years ahead, regular maintenance is key. Beginning by cleaning your devices on a regular basis; dust and debris can accumulate and hinder efficiency. For refrigerators, check the door seals and tidy the coils to keep them effective. Laundry your cleaning maker's drum and dispensers to stop mold and mildew and odors.Don' t neglect to inspect tubes and connections for leaks or put on. For dishwashing machines, run a cleansing cycle month-to-month to confirm correct water drainage and remove odors.Keep an eye on any kind of unusual noises or performance concerns-- addressing these early can avoid costly repair work down the line (Washer dryer repair service Dependable Refrigeration). Ultimately, describe your appliance guidebooks for certain maintenance pointers and advised solution intervals. By embracing these practices, you'll not just extend the life of your home appliances but additionally enhance their effectiveness, conserving you money and time in the future
